On 5/24/21 9:25 PM, Damien Le Moal wrote:
> A target map method requesting the requeue of a bio with
> DM_MAPIO_REQUEUE or completing it with DM_ENDIO_REQUEUE can cause
> unaligned write errors if the bio is a write operation targeting a
> sequential zone. If a zoned target request such a requeue, warn about
> it and kill the IO.
> 
> The function dm_is_zone_write() is introduced to detect write operations
> to zoned targets.
> 
> This change does not affect the target drivers supporting zoned devices
> and exposing a zoned device, namely dm-crypt, dm-linear and dm-flakey as
> none of these targets ever request a requeue.

> +bool dm_is_zone_write(struct mapped_device *md, struct bio *bio)
> +{
> +	struct request_queue *q = md->queue;
> +
> +	if (!blk_queue_is_zoned(q))
> +		return false;
> +
> +	switch (bio_op(bio)) {
> +	case REQ_OP_WRITE_ZEROES:
> +	case REQ_OP_WRITE_SAME:
> +	case REQ_OP_WRITE:
> +		return !op_is_flush(bio->bi_opf) && bio_sectors(bio);
> +	default:
> +		return false;
> +	}
> +}
